How can one determine the conditions under which they should enter or exit a crypto-trade position?

There are several factors to consider when determining when to enter or exit a crypto-trade position. These include technical analysis, fundamental analysis, market sentiment, and risk management.

Technical analysis involves the use of charts and technical indicators to identify patterns and trends that can indicate when to buy or sell. For example, a breakout above a key resistance level on a chart may be a signal to buy, while a breakdown below a key support level may be a signal to sell.

Fundamental analysis looks at the underlying factors that can affect the value of a crypto-asset. This includes factors such as the overall health of the crypto-market, the technology behind the asset, and the team developing the asset.

Market sentiment is the overall attitude or feeling of the market about a particular crypto-asset. This can be determined by studying social media, news articles, and other sources of information.

Risk management is the process of identifying and managing the risks associated with trading crypto-assets. This includes setting stop-losses, diversifying your portfolio and not risking more than you can afford to lose.

It's important to note that no single factor should be relied upon exclusively, instead, it's recommended to consider a combination of factors, to create a more holistic view of the market situation.Also, it's crucial to have a well-defined trading plan in place, outlining specific entry and exit points, as well as risk management strategy. This will help you stay disciplined and avoid impulsive decisions based on emotions.
